How to fill out the Osha Form 174 online

The Osha Form 174, also known as the Material Safety Data Sheet, is essential for ensuring that hazardous material information is communicated effectively. This guide will provide you with clear steps to fill out the form online, ensuring compliance with Osha's Hazard Communication Standard.

Follow the steps to complete the Osha Form 174 online.

  1. Click 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the form and open it in the editor.
  2. In Section I, fill in the identity of the material as used on the label and the list. Ensure you write 'Play-Doh' in the appropriate field. Leave no blank spaces; if an item is not applicable, mark the space accordingly.
  3. Complete the manufacturer’s name, address, emergency telephone number, information telephone number, and the date prepared in Section I. You may also include the signature of the preparer if applicable.
  4. In Section II, list any hazardous ingredients if applicable. For this example, you would note 'NONE – MIXTURE OF FOOD APPROVED CHEMICALS'.
  5. Fill out Section III by noting the physical and chemical characteristics, such as specific gravity and appearance. Enter any other relevant information like boiling point or melting point if needed.
  6. For Section IV, provide information about fire and explosion hazard data. If certain items are not applicable, indicate this clearly.
  7. Proceed to Section V to describe reactivity data and ensure to indicate stability and any conditions to avoid. Use the appropriate checkboxes to note if hazardous polymerization may occur.
  8. Complete Section VI by detailing health hazard data, ensuring to provide necessary information about routes of entry and any health hazards associated.
  9. In Section VII, specify precautions for safe handling and use. Describe the steps to take in case of a spill and waste disposal methods.
  10. Finish filling out Section VIII regarding control measures, specifying any necessary protective equipment or practices.

OSHA Form 174, also known as the Material Safety Data Sheet, is a standardized format used to communicate information regarding hazards related to chemicals. This form is vital for ensuring workplace safety and regulatory compliance. By utilizing OSHA Form 174, employers can effectively inform employees about proper handling and emergency procedures.
